Output 61fe7f21e9ee88a419c701d5492a92b70a04ecb29a6820525b16e4328b745097:1

value
21769334977
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d32ca6cc10b45b1b8c94517c2e3a26f74c14a41 OP_EQUALVERIFY OP_CHECKSIG
address
1JFPZFv9aY8pBDZQGHu21TpAEE2iurnk5Z
transaction
61fe7f21e9ee88a419c701d5492a92b70a04ecb29a6820525b16e4328b745097
spent
true